Cylinder beads

Nubian
Napatan Period, reign of Karkamani
519–510 B.C.
Findspot: Nubia (Sudan), Nuri, Pyramid VII, room A

Medium/Technique Amazonite, serpentine
Dimensions Length: 1.8 cm (11/16 in.)
Credit Line Harvard University—Boston Museum of Fine Arts Expedition
Accession Number17-1-274
NOT ON VIEW
ClassificationsJewelry / AdornmentBeads

DescriptionNine amazonite beads and nine serpentine beads.
ProvenanceFrom Nuri, pyramid VII, room A. 1917: excavated by the Harvard University-Museum of Fine Arts Expedition; assigned to the MFA by the government of the Sudan.
